Borrow safely

Every offer on RupeeRahi names its regulated entity with a source link and a last-checked date. Before you sign anywhere — here or elsewhere — check three things:

The lender names its regulated entity and shows a Key Facts Statement (KFS)
The APR and all fees are stated before you accept — not after
There is a grievance officer and an RBI ombudsman route if something goes wrong

How fast can I get money?
That depends on the lender. Many lenders in this segment advertise same-day disbursal once KYC and approval are complete — confirm the timeline in the lender’s own Key Facts Statement before you apply.
Can I get a loan with a low credit score?
Some lenders consider applicants with a low or thin CIBIL history, usually at higher rates and smaller amounts. Compare the total repayable — not just the EMI — before accepting any offer. See the low-CIBIL loan guide →
